Transaction d73e324916b648062d6715ccc2dd096d404514440da1595e182fd46f119e91a8

3 Input
1 Outputs
  • d73e324916b648062d6715ccc2dd096d404514440da1595e182fd46f119e91a8:0
  • value  263653
    address  3HcznpPZ2f2G9x7hJJAc5JL1ZJ8bLrM2BF